The Rise of the Agentic Al
Dude, forget just *using* AI. Microsoft is rolling out “agentic AI”. Imagine computers not just crunching numbers, but actually *thinking* like scientists. These AI systems are designed to autonomously come up with ideas, run experiments (virtually, of course), analyze the results, and learn from their mistakes, all without a human holding their hand every step of the way. Microsoft’s platform, codenamed “Discovery”, is the star of the show, with the goal of compressing years of research into mere *hours*. Think about it: instead of spending ages in a lab, scientists can use AI to explore a million different possibilities, which is way more than any human could. The original article points out that they identified a new chemical compound in a mere 200 hours – that’s a game-changer in a field where innovation can take years. This means better materials, faster, and potentially, breakthroughs in everything from medicine to, well, whatever else needs a scientific boost. This is not just about making things go faster; it’s about allowing scientists to venture where they just couldn’t before.
Revolutionizing Healthcare: Data, Diagnostics, and Drug Discovery
Here’s where things get personal for everyone. AI is poised to shake up healthcare from top to bottom. The main issue is the overwhelming amount of data—genomic information, medical images, patient records—all of which is just a data swamp. Microsoft is developing methods to cut through the clutter and address the biases in the data, making it easier to find patterns and make breakthroughs. Think of AI as a super-powered librarian, organizing a vast library of medical information and helping doctors find exactly what they need, when they need it. They’re even using AI to help patients find clinical trials faster, which speeds up the process of bringing new treatments to market. It’s all about making healthcare more efficient, more accurate, and, ultimately, more effective.
AI isn’t just about diagnosing diseases or speeding up clinical trials; it’s fundamentally changing the drug discovery process. Microsoft is partnering with organizations like the Global Health Drug Discovery Initiative to hunt for new drugs, particularly those needed to combat infectious diseases. The original article references Project Science Engine, which uses AI and high-performance computing to accelerate research in areas like biopharma and materials science. The power of AI enables them to discover new drug candidates and optimize their molecular structure. The Microsoft AI Diagnostic Orchestrator (MAI-DxO) is another example, which is all about creating AI-powered diagnostic tools that can actually improve patient outcomes. And let’s not forget the NIH STRIDES Initiative, which provides scientists with access to affordable cloud technology. This is a real, tangible move towards using tech to make the world a better and healthier place.
